Oprah Winfrey is on the look out for a new talk show host, and Zach Anner, who auditioned for the job is at the top of the list. Rumors has it that Oprah doesn’t want Zach to win though Anner has received more than 2.5 million votes, nearly double the number of the number 2 ranked competitor. Although, votes on myown.oprah.com don’t necessarily secure the winner his or her own show. The top five will be flown to Los Angeles, where producers will select 10 cast members for a reality competition series on Winfrey’s new network.

Zach Anner who has cerebral palsy, describes himself as a “wheelchair-bound lady magnet” and his motor condition as “the sexiest of the palsies”. Anner, attended the University of Texas, made a hilarious and charismatic pitch for a travel show, and his video has become widely shared on the Internet, including by blues/pop musician, singer and social networker John Mayer.
